Roux is a mixture of flour and fat cooked together and used to thicken sauces. Roux is typically made from equal parts of flour and fat by weight. The flour is added to the melted fat or oil on the stove top, blended until smooth, and cooked to the desired level of brownness. A roux can be white, blond (darker) or brown. WebJun 21, 2024 · 2. Blonde roux: Similar to a white roux, a blonde roux can be used to thicken any white sauce. It’s cooked for a few minutes longer than a white roux and develops a mild, nutty flavor.
